Quote:
6.2L V8 Engine
Horsepower: 620
Torque: 550 ft-lb
Saleen Supercharger
Low Pressure Drop Internal Intercooler
High Volume Intercooler Water Pump with Closed Single Pass System
Remote External Heat Exchanger
High Performance Calibration
47lb Fuel Injectors
Cold Air Induction with High Performance Air Filter
Polished Stainless Steel Exhaust Tips and Mufflers
6-Speed Manual Transmission
625 AMP Maintenance Free Battery
